CLAUDIUS II, (A.D. 268-270), billon antoninianus, Cyzicus mint, (4.03 grams), obv. radiate bust to right, DIVO CLAVDIO, rev. CONSECRATIO, pyramidal crematorium of three stories two figures on second storey, (S.11466, cf.RIC 256). Extremely fine.

Ex Noble Numismatics Sale 87 (lot 4368 part).
